Boleh\! Boleh\! Indonesian Nasi Padang brings authentic Indonesian flavors to Marsiling Mall Hawker Centre, serving traditional Padang-style rice dishes that celebrate the rich culinary heritage of West Sumatra with bold spices, complex flavors, and diverse accompaniments. This specialized Indonesian stall offers northern Singapore residents access to authentic Nasi Padang without traveling to traditional Indonesian food districts, making regional Southeast Asian cuisine accessible within neighborhood hawker settings.

The stall's offerings likely include fragrant coconut rice served with various curries, rendang, ayam pop, sambal dishes, and vegetable preparations that showcase the complex spice blends and cooking techniques that define Padang cuisine. Each dish reflects the intricate flavor layering and aromatic spice combinations that have made Indonesian food beloved throughout Southeast Asia, with presentations that allow customers to create personalized combinations suited to their spice tolerance and preferences.

The enthusiastic Boleh\! Boleh\! name reflects the positive, welcoming spirit of Indonesian hospitality while serving Singapore's diverse population that includes Indonesian expatriates, local families with regional connections, and adventurous food lovers seeking authentic Southeast Asian flavors. The stall contributes to Marsiling Mall's multicultural dining landscape, demonstrating how hawker centers successfully integrate diverse regional cuisines into Singapore's unified food culture.
